Transaction bde8324ae9936cdcb67b731b07ce8fe2969e18ad6bb80a906403013e78767cb4

1 Input
1 Outputs
  • bde8324ae9936cdcb67b731b07ce8fe2969e18ad6bb80a906403013e78767cb4:0
  • value  456551
    address  38D81eTF25Lcm4o4atdXFCaVoTKtSRf4WN